President Al-Assad accepts the credentials of the ambassadors of Mauritania and Argentina to Syria

On April 11th, President Bashar Al-Assad accepted the credentials of Ahmed Adi Muhammad Al-Razi as Ambassador of the Islamic Republic of Mauritania and Sebastian Zavala as Ambassador of the Argentine Republic to the Syrian Arab Republic.

President al-Assad received the two ambassadors separately, exchanged talks with them, and wished them success in their duties.

The two ambassadors were received and invited to the People’s Palace in the usual ceremony.

The ceremony for presenting the credentials was attended by Dr. Faisal Al-Miqdad, Minister of Foreign Affairs and Expatriates, and Mansour Azzam, Minister of Presidential Affairs.
